Back-End Software Engineer - Streaming Data & Metrics Platform (remote)

New Relic, Inc.

Kansas City Missouri

United States

Information Technology
(No Timezone Provided)

Description

We are excited to consider a remote engineer for this role. Remote team members will be encouraged to work out of their home office.

Please note that visa sponsorship is not available for this position.

Your Opportunity

The Telemetry Data Platform group at New Relic builds the foundation for all of our products: data ingestion transformation, storage and retrieval. As an engineer in this group, you’ll participate in the development of the streaming systems that are vital to our strategy.

If the idea of working on systems that process millions of messages per second and handle petabytes of data while working on a team that values emotional intelligence, collaboration, and mentorship excites you, you enjoy solving tough technical problems at “machine scale”, then you may be exactly what we're looking for!

What You’ll Do

  • Build, maintain and scale highly available, real-time, distributed services, and high throughput data processing pipelines.
  • Diagnose and solve problems in operating high throughput services and distributed systems including dealing with coordination, concurrency, and resource efficiency.
  • Ship high-quality code incrementally and often, balancing operational needs with new feature development.
  • Understand your team’s workflows, constraints, roles, ceremonies, purpose, and needs from the business.
  • Familiarize yourself with your product's services, learning about the service catalog your team is responsible for.
  • Own and improve team processes
  • Your Qualifications

    This team member will focus on our high-performance data pipelines and data APIs, modernizing our architecture to support our next magnitude of growth.

    Must-haves:

  • 3+ years professional experience in software development
  • Production-level experience in Java, Java design patterns, and history of delivery
  • Driven to learn new technologies
  • Interest in the performance monitoring domain
  • Adaptable and flexible to new teams and problems
  • You are curious about how modern browsers work, the vast amounts of data they process, and what that data can tell you about your app
  • Nice-to-haves:

  • Bachelor’s degree in Computer Science
  • The majority of our code is written in Java, experience dealing with concurrency in Java is especially advantageous.
  • Exposure to Terraform and an understanding of distributed systems
  • Exposure to Kubernetes and/or Kafka
  • Experience solving operational issues through the use of telemetry data, command-line tools, and knowledge of the JVM.
  • Experience in operations for production cloud applications
  • We're looking for bold and passionate people to be a part of our mission to create more perfect software. We'd love to have you apply, even if you don't feel you meet every single requirement. What's most important to us is finding authentic and accountable people who feel connected to our mission and values, not just candidates who check off all the boxes.

    We will ensure that individuals with disabilities are provided a reasonable accommodation to participate in the job application or interview process, to perform essential job functions, and to receive other benefits and privileges of employment. Please contact us to request an accommodation.

    About us:

    New Relic (NYSE: NEWR) is the industry’s largest and most comprehensive cloud-based instrumentation platform built to create more perfect software. The world’s best software and DevOps teams rely on New Relic to move faster, make better decisions, and create best-in-class digital experiences. If you run software, you need to run New Relic. We’re proudly trusted by more than 50% of the Fortune 100.

    Founded in 2008, we’re a global company focused on building a culture where all employees feel a deep sense of belonging, where every ‘Relic’ can bring their whole self to work and feel supported and empowered to thrive. We’re consistently recognized as a distinguished employer and are committed to building best-in-class products and an award-winning culture.

    Back-End Software Engineer - Streaming Data & Metrics Platform (remote)

    New Relic, Inc.

    Kansas City Missouri

    United States

    Information Technology

    (No Timezone Provided)

    Description

    We are excited to consider a remote engineer for this role. Remote team members will be encouraged to work out of their home office.

    Please note that visa sponsorship is not available for this position.

    Your Opportunity

    The Telemetry Data Platform group at New Relic builds the foundation for all of our products: data ingestion transformation, storage and retrieval. As an engineer in this group, you’ll participate in the development of the streaming systems that are vital to our strategy.

    If the idea of working on systems that process millions of messages per second and handle petabytes of data while working on a team that values emotional intelligence, collaboration, and mentorship excites you, you enjoy solving tough technical problems at “machine scale”, then you may be exactly what we're looking for!

    What You’ll Do

  • Build, maintain and scale highly available, real-time, distributed services, and high throughput data processing pipelines.
  • Diagnose and solve problems in operating high throughput services and distributed systems including dealing with coordination, concurrency, and resource efficiency.
  • Ship high-quality code incrementally and often, balancing operational needs with new feature development.
  • Understand your team’s workflows, constraints, roles, ceremonies, purpose, and needs from the business.
  • Familiarize yourself with your product's services, learning about the service catalog your team is responsible for.
  • Own and improve team processes
  • Your Qualifications

    This team member will focus on our high-performance data pipelines and data APIs, modernizing our architecture to support our next magnitude of growth.

    Must-haves:

  • 3+ years professional experience in software development
  • Production-level experience in Java, Java design patterns, and history of delivery
  • Driven to learn new technologies
  • Interest in the performance monitoring domain
  • Adaptable and flexible to new teams and problems
  • You are curious about how modern browsers work, the vast amounts of data they process, and what that data can tell you about your app
  • Nice-to-haves:

  • Bachelor’s degree in Computer Science
  • The majority of our code is written in Java, experience dealing with concurrency in Java is especially advantageous.
  • Exposure to Terraform and an understanding of distributed systems
  • Exposure to Kubernetes and/or Kafka
  • Experience solving operational issues through the use of telemetry data, command-line tools, and knowledge of the JVM.
  • Experience in operations for production cloud applications
  • We're looking for bold and passionate people to be a part of our mission to create more perfect software. We'd love to have you apply, even if you don't feel you meet every single requirement. What's most important to us is finding authentic and accountable people who feel connected to our mission and values, not just candidates who check off all the boxes.

    We will ensure that individuals with disabilities are provided a reasonable accommodation to participate in the job application or interview process, to perform essential job functions, and to receive other benefits and privileges of employment. Please contact us to request an accommodation.

    About us:

    New Relic (NYSE: NEWR) is the industry’s largest and most comprehensive cloud-based instrumentation platform built to create more perfect software. The world’s best software and DevOps teams rely on New Relic to move faster, make better decisions, and create best-in-class digital experiences. If you run software, you need to run New Relic. We’re proudly trusted by more than 50% of the Fortune 100.

    Founded in 2008, we’re a global company focused on building a culture where all employees feel a deep sense of belonging, where every ‘Relic’ can bring their whole self to work and feel supported and empowered to thrive. We’re consistently recognized as a distinguished employer and are committed to building best-in-class products and an award-winning culture.